Nutrition Facts

Catfish, baked or broiled, made with butter

Serving Size: small catfish (yield after cooking, bone removed) (163g)

* Amount Per Serving
Calories 282 cal
Calories from Fat 152.1 cal
% Daily Value
Total Fat 16.9 g 26%
Saturated Fat 5.8 g 29%
Cholesterol 122.3 mg 40.8%
Sodium 718.8 mg 30%
Total Carbohydrate 0.2 g 0.1%
Dietary Fiber 0 g 0%
Sugars (Added) 0 g 0%
Protein 30.4 g 60.8%
 
Vitamins
Vitamin A 141.3 IU 2.8%
Vitamin B6 0.3 mg 13.9%
Vitamin B12 4.9 mcg 81.5%
Vitamin C 0.8 mg 1.4%
Vitamin D 0.5 mcg 0.1%
Vitamin E 0 mg 0%
Vitamin K 4.6 mcg 5.7%
 
Minerals
Calcium (Ca) 17.9 mg 1.6%
Copper (Cu) 0.1 mg 3.3%
Iron (Fe) 0.5 mg 2.6%
Magnesium (Mg) 37.5 mg 9.4%
Manganese (Mn) 0 mg 0%
Potassium (K) 604.7 mg 17.3%
Phosphorus (P) 407.5 mg 40.8%
Selenium (Se) 16.5 mcg 23.5%
Zinc (Zn) 1 mg 6.4%
